Best Tie-Dye Hacks for Reviving Faded T-Shirts Without Bleach

Are your favorite tie-dye t-shirts starting to look a little dull? Fear not! You can revive those faded colors and bring new life to your wardrobe without using harsh chemicals like bleach. In this blog post, we'll explore some creative and effective tie-dye hacks that will help you restore the vibrancy of your t-shirts while keeping them in great shape.

Understanding Tie-Dye Fading

Before diving into the hacks, it's essential to understand why tie-dye shirts fade over time. Factors such as sun exposure, frequent washing, and the quality of dye used can cause colors to lose their luster. Fortunately, there are several methods you can use to refresh those faded designs without resorting to bleach.

Re-Dye with Fabric Paints

One of the simplest ways to revive your faded tie-dye t-shirt is to apply fabric paints.

  • Choose Your Colors : Select fabric paints that match or complement the existing colors on your shirt.
  • Prepare the Shirt : Lay the shirt flat and make sure it's clean and dry.
  • Apply the Paint : Use brushes, sponges, or spray bottles to apply the paint. You can touch up faded areas or create new designs altogether.
  • Set the Paint : Follow the manufacturer's instructions for setting the paint, usually involving heat from an iron or letting it air dry completely.

Use Natural Dyes

If you prefer a more eco-friendly approach, consider using natural dyes made from fruits, vegetables, or flowers.

  • Gather Ingredients : Common natural dye sources include beet juice (for reds), turmeric (for yellows), and spinach (for greens).
  • Create the Dye Bath : Boil your chosen ingredient in water to extract the color. Strain out the solids and let the liquid cool.
  • Soak the Shirt : Submerge your faded t-shirt in the dye bath for a few hours, checking periodically until you achieve the desired shade.
  • Rinse and Dry : Rinse the shirt in cold water and hang it to dry away from direct sunlight.

Tie-Dye Over Existing Patterns

Transform fading into a new design by layering fresh tie-dye patterns over your old ones.

  • Choose New Colors : Pick bright, bold colors that will stand out against the faded background.
  • Plan Your Design : Decide whether you want to create swirls, stripes, or other patterns. Use rubber bands or string to secure sections of the shirt if needed.
  • Dye Application : Apply the new dye using squeeze bottles or spray bottles for a more controlled effect. Let the dye sit according to package instructions.
  • Rinse and Set : After the dye has set, rinse the shirt thoroughly and follow any additional setting instructions.

Ombre Technique

The ombre technique is another great way to refresh a faded shirt while incorporating a trendy style.

  • Select Colors : Choose one or two colors close to the existing faded ones for a seamless transition.
  • Dampen the Shirt : Lightly dampen the shirt with water to help the dye absorb better.
  • Apply Dye Gradually : Start with the darkest color at the bottom and gradually blend lighter shades toward the top. Use a spray bottle or sponge to create a smooth gradient.
  • Dry and Set : Allow the shirt to dry fully before washing it. Follow dye setting instructions for best results.

Tie-Dye with Markers

For a quick and easy hack, use permanent markers to add color back into your faded shirt.

  • Gather Supplies : You'll need permanent markers in various colors, rubbing alcohol, and a spray bottle.
  • Create Designs : Use the markers to draw or color in faded areas. You can also create new patterns or designs.
  • Blend with Alcohol : Lightly spray the marked areas with rubbing alcohol to help the ink spread and blend, mimicking a tie-dye effect.
  • Allow to Dry : Let your shirt dry completely before wearing or washing.
